Vlookup/Lookup Value in Query Editor/M Language
Hello, Is there a way to do a vlookup/lookup value calculation in the query editor using M Language? I believe the Merge function is one way to acheive this. However in my dataset that I am try...
Aron_Moore
6 years agoSolution Specialist
Merge is the way to go. Duplicate the query where you want the lookup values and then disable the load so it doesn't come into your model.
- Anonymous6 years agoNot applicable
Aron_Moore thanks for the reply. If I disable the load will new changes come in? The query I am specifically thinking about is a list of employees so I need to make sure it is refreshing to add new employess.
Thanks again!
- Aron_Moore6 years agoSolution Specialist
Yes, it will continue to refresh along with your other data. Disabling the load just prevents the table from coming into your model.
